A semicolon as a super comma is used when you're <u>listing a set of things that have a comma within them.</u> This usually applies with locations and names. For example, in the sentence "In Europe, I've visited Paris, France; Vienna, Austria; and Prague, Czech Republic.", the semicolon is used as a super comma to separate the list of cities in their countries.
